7 Edith Sophia ZUELLIG2,3 (1911-2007) [95]. Born 18 Jan 1911, At the home of her grandparents, George and Celia Wright in Birch Run, MI.3 Died 19 Jun 2007, Frankenmuth, Saginaw County, MI.3 Buried Oakwood Mausoleum, Saginaw, MI.3

The following information was provided by Edith Zuellig Zeilinger on a tour of the area with Kenneth D. Wright on May 20, 2000.

At the time of Edith's birth, her parents were living in a home previously owned by her grandparents, George and Celia Wright. This home was the first home of George and Celia and was located on Courtney Road, between Gara Road and Old Plank Road (Now Dixie Hwy). The road has been renamed Wenn Road and the home still exists at 10375 Wenn Road. George and Hatti Zuellig then moved to a 40 acre farm on Canada Road east of Block Road. The barn is still in existence (May, 2000) at 12627 Canada Road. Edith remembers walking to a school, also located on Canada Road but was unable to identify where it was for sure. George Zuellig's brother Charles, owned a farm on the south east corner of Block and Canada Roads and that structure still exists. Another brother of George, owned a farm on the west side of Block Road 1/2 mile north of Canada Road. Edith married Charles Zeilinger in 1933 and they built their first house in 1935 on 130 Franklin in Frankenmuth. The house still stands in immaculate condition. In May of 1965 they moved to 444 Mary Cove, only a few block away. In 1978 they moved to an apartment at 227 Churchgrove Road, where Edith still lives today. (May, 2000). All three of her last residences are within a 1/2 mile radius.

14 George Willisbold ZUELLIG2,4,5,6 (1889-1956) [91]. Born 24 Jan 1889, MI.4,6 Marr Hattie E. WRIGHT 28 May 1910.4 Died 20 Mar 1956, MI.4

George and Hatti Zuellig owned the Hotel in Birch Run. It was originally built in 1907 and was first named Schmitzer's Hotel.

From the Clio Messenger.

January 26, 1912 - "George Zuellig is busy now days looking up a good farm team."

April 26, 1912 - "Mr. and Mrs. George Zuellig visited at Charles Zuellig's Sunday."

1926-04-01 - "George Zuellig has traded his farm formerly the Frank Cullen farm to Thomas Johnson for the Hotel building."

1926-04-29 - "George Zuellig has made a great improvement in the hotel building by the addition of a coat of paint."

1927-05-19 - "George Zuellig is building a fine new residence on East Main street."

1929-01-31 - "George Zuellig was surprised by several friends Saturday evening, the occasion being his birthday.".
